Output ff221eece9a8607180909ccdfd39a559783a462dbbffd366fc979034d6cc9bec:69

value
370435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 150ecd1c46958f7df94736791bce0f13da4f5e9a OP_EQUAL
address
33cMqyhrvoxcaYLgYGTmk3iCuYLqktci5k
transaction
ff221eece9a8607180909ccdfd39a559783a462dbbffd366fc979034d6cc9bec
confirmations
125887
spent
true